I am a last born in our family. Studied up to A level & did a course in business admin. in college. My first few days wasn't so rosy in terms of job seeking. Since I was in school, I longed to have my own business. My first working experience was to do a sales and marketing job which I managed to Save
and start my own business. My achievement is that I managed to have my own food store. What's good here is that I can be able to manage my time and resources for my success.
My business is a food store. I deal with selling of cereals. This items have a high demand because every person needs food to servive. My typical costs is kshs 15000 to 20000 ($ 147-191)a.month.with an average monthly income of 50000 ($ 477). I use the proceeds in Reinvestment in growing up the business, paying up school fees for my children and meeting other household demands like house rent and water bills.
If I get the loan I will dedicate it to buying of cereals like maize ($ 48), beans ($ 60), wheat ($ 58) etc. The loan is going to benefit me so Much because I am expecting to get an increase of More than 25% of sales an addition on top of the current about 55% monthly sales.
